SEN Teacher required for September 2024 in Harrow

Career Teachers is currently working with a mainstream primary school in Harrow who will be opening an ARP for pupils with Autism in September 2024.

This vacancy is an exciting opportunity for a teacher with SEND experience who would like to step up to an ARP Class Teacher role.

The school will also consider experienced mainstream class teachers looking to transition into an SEN Teacher.

This opportunity is a long term contract for the whole of the next Academic year with the school looking to take the teacher on permanently in September 2025.

The school is looking for someone who can:

* Work with the ARP team in the development of SEND provision
* Demonstrate a strong knowledge of Autism
* Demonstrate knowledge and understanding in the SEN code of practice and EHCP process
* Make consistent judgements based on careful analysis of available evidence
* Set targets, monitor, evaluate and record progress
* Demonstrate good communication, presentation and organisational skills
